My personal experience tells me that this is the way to go.  There are many
kayak rentals on Kauai but they primarily rent sit-on-tops.  A few have
decked boats, but they are doubles.  Also, many would only rent if you
purchased a tour.  So, the next time I go, I'll have a Feathercraft shipped
over there.
